Gluten Free Beer Bread

13 ingredients
10 steps

Ingredients

  • 1 egg
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up rice flour
  • 1/3 cup potato starch
  • 2/3 cup tapioca starch
  • 1 tablespoon xanthan gum
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 3 tablespoons brown s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on dill weed
  • 12 ounces gluten-free beer (Gluten free, of course! I used Redbridge)
  • 1 tablespoon butter, melted (optional)

Directions

  1. 1
    Preheat oven to 350°F.
  2. 2
    Liberally grease a 9x5-inch bread pan.
  3. 3
    Mix together egg with salt.
  4. 4
    Add in dry ingredients: flour, starches, xanthum gum, baking powder, brown sugar, baking soda and dill. Stir lightly to combine.
  5. 5
    Add in about half of the beer and mix just until ingredients are wet.
  6. 6
    Add in the remaining beer and mix until combined.
  7. 7
    Pour the bread dough into the bread pan. Top with melted butter if desired.
  8. 8
    Bake for 45 minutes.
  9. 9
    Remove bread from pan and allow to cool on a wire rack for 10 minutes.
  10. 10
    Enjoy!
